Job Description

Infant Care Teacher We are seeking a nurturing, dependable, and attentive Infant Care Teacher to provide a safe, loving, and engaging environment for infants. The ideal candidate is passionate about early childhood development, understands the unique needs of infants, and is committed to supporting each child's growth through responsive caregiving and age-appropriate activities. Responsibilities Provide attentive and responsive care to infants, including feeding, diapering, soothing, and maintaining nap schedules Create a warm, safe, and stimulating classroom environment that promotes healthy development and exploration Plan and implement age-appropriate activities that encourage sensory, motor, cognitive, and social-emotional development Maintain consistent daily routines while responding to each infant's individual needs Observe and document children's developmental progress and communicate regularly with parents and guardians Ensure cleanliness and sanitation of classroom materials, toys, bottles, and sleeping areas Follow all licensing regulations, health and safety standards, and center policies Supervise infants closely at all times to ensure their safety and well-being Collaborate with fellow teachers and staff to maintain a positive and supportive team environment Comfort and nurture infants with patience, care, and positive interactions throughout the day Qualifications & Skills Previous experience working with infants in a childcare or daycare setting preferred Knowledge of infant development and appropriate caregiving practices Ability to multitask and manage a structured infant classroom routine Patient, compassionate, and dependable with a genuine love for children Strong communication and interpersonal skills Ability to lift, carry, and move infants and classroom equipment as needed CPR and First Aid Certification (or willingness to obtain) Must meet all state licensing requirements for childcare staff Preferred Qualities Warm and nurturing personality Team-oriented mindset Reliable attendance and punctuality Ability to build trusting relationships with families and children
